Caring for your emotional health is also part of rebuilding a life abroad
Moving country can broaden your horizons, but it can also bring emotional challenges that aren't always easy to name. Cultural adaptation, distance from your support network, constant worry, the feeling of isolation, and shifts in how you see yourself in the world can make this experience emotionally draining.
Individual therapy offers a safe, welcoming space to understand what you're going through, navigate this process with more emotional clarity, and develop inner resources to build a life with more balance and belonging.
